DekelOil update on being a “certified producer of palm oil”

DekelOil Public Limited (LON:DKL), operator and 51% owner of the vertically integrated Ayenouan palm oil project in Cote d’Ivoire, has told DirectorsTalk it has made significant progress towards achieving its objective to become a certified producer of palm oil in line with the standards set by the Round Table for Sustainable Palm Oil (‘RSPO’), which is recognised globally as a certification standard for sustainable palm oil. DekelOil has been a member of RSPO since 2008.

— DekelOil’s objective is to become the first RSPO certified, fully functioning producer of crude palm oil in Cote d’Ivoire and to be among the first in West Africa

— DekelOil has engaged Proforest, an internationally recognised environmental and social consulting group based in Oxford (United Kingdom), to assist with the implementation of social and environmental programmes to prepare its Milling operations and oil palm estates for certification

— The Mill is anticipated to be certified first with the Company’s oil palm estates to be certified within three years of the completion of the Mill certification

— Proforest has been working with DekelOil over the past 12 months and completed a baseline assessment of DekelOil’s activities against the requirements of the RSPO Principles and Criteria resulting in a detailed action plan

o DekelOil subsequently formed a Certification Committee chaired by the Chief Executive Office, Youval Rasin and has now made significant progress against the action plan

— Successful membership application will clearly differentiate DekelOil from its peers, reinforcing its status as a responsible producer
